In a decisive crackdown on cybercrime, the operatives of the Gombe Zonal Command of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) have apprehended 27 individuals suspected of engaging in internet fraud. The operation, conducted on Thursday, February 22, 2024, targeted specific locations namely D&D Apartment and Bubes Hotel, situated in Yelwa, Bauchi State.
The arrest follows meticulous intelligence gathering which pointed towards the alleged involvement of the suspects in various internet-related offenses. Upon raiding the aforementioned premises, law enforcement officers successfully apprehended the suspects in question.
A notable haul of confiscated items was reported, underscoring the scale of the illicit activities allegedly perpetrated by the apprehended individuals. Among the seized possessions were a BMW car, numerous iPhones, iPads, laptops, and a desktop computer.
The EFCC has emphasized its commitment to thorough investigation procedures, ensuring that due process is followed. Consequently, the suspects will undergo comprehensive scrutiny as part of the investigative process. Once investigations are concluded, the apprehended individuals will be promptly arraigned before the appropriate judicial authorities to face charges related to their alleged involvement in internet fraud.
